Event Coordinator and Community Liaison

Purpose

Grace United Methodist Church of Spencer, Iowa is seeking a candidate for the position of Event Coordinator and Community Liaison. This position will focus on two priorities:

  • Build and maintain community partnerships that align with Grace UMC mission and values to promote facility use and building usage contracts.
  • Guide processes, establish protocols, coordinate with ministry teams, and provide documentation for planning events connected to ministries.
     

 Duties

  • Meet with community leaders to build relationships, collaborate to identify needs, and coordinate potential partnership opportunities for Grace UMC facility usage.
  • Identify opportunities for Grace UMC facility through community partnerships.
  • Ensure building usage partnerships are consistent with the values, goals, and mission of Grace UMC.
  • Establish , manage, and provide support for building usage contracts.
  • Establish and maintain up-to-date building usage calendar.
  • Identify opportunities for ministry growth through events and community engagement.
  • Work closely with Grace UMC ministry leaders to integrate events into their ministry committee plans and goals.
  • Develop and manage the protocol of event planning with committees and program leaders within Grace UMC leadership.
  • Assist in creating and distributing event marketing materials through various channels including church bulletins, website, social media, email, newsletters, print marketing, etc.
  • Facilitate communication and collaboration between ministry teams to ensure consistent, efficient, and well-coordinated efforts.
  • Encourage and collaborate on Grace UMC current and future vision, mission, and goals with Grace UMC leadership members.
  • Oversee all aspects of event planning and coordinating between Grace UMC leadership team and partnering leadership.
  • Establish, train, and manage leadership personnel regarding proper documentation, information, and follow-up around building use, events, and program ministry.
  • Manage event logistics on-site, ensuring smooth execution and addressing any issues that arise.
  • Prepare reports on event outcomes and impact for church leadership.
  • Present to Grace UMC Leadership team feedback and successes regarding processes, protocols, and outcomes
  • Maintain accurate event records that include attendance tracking, budget monitoring, and vendor contracts.
  • Recruit, train, and mobilize leadership team and volunteers to support various ministry events and activities.
  • Communicate event details to church members and potential participants effectively.
  • Assign clear roles and responsibilities to volunteers based on their skills and interests.
  • Foster a positive volunteer experience through recognition and appreciation.  
Requirements
Necessary Skills Self-motivated with a strong sense of integrity and accountability. Exceptional organ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ously.  Excellent verbal and written communication skills with the ability to effectively interact with diverse groups of people professionally. Excellent interpersonal skills with the ability to implement conflict management skills as needed. Creative thinking and ability to develop engaging event concepts and unique building usage opportunities.  Basic computer proficiency, i.e., Microsoft Office, use of email, digital communication, and online calendar. Time management and accurate time tracking via shared calendars. Ability to gain an understanding of church operations and ministry dynamics.  Ability to celebrate successes and accept constructive feedback to continuously improve strategies, protocols, & overall outcomes. Expectations Passion for serving the church community while promoting spiritual growth, and embracing ongoing personal development as a Disciple of Jesus Christ. Complete tasks in alignment with Grace UMC’s vision and mission. Staff advocate on from the Staff Parish Relations Committee monthly. Support Funds provided for meals to encourage networking opportunities. Cell phone and service provided for communication work.  Church-owned device provided to create marketing materials, pamphlets, contract templates, and document creation. Scheduled monthly supervision, support, & guidance. Salary half-time: $25,000  20 hours weekly average for the year
